To play this Blu-ray in Australia you must have a Blu-ray player that can play all Region A,B and C Blu-rays\u003c\/p\u003e \n\n\u003cp\u003ePlease note image may vary\u003c\/p\u003e \n\n\u003cp\u003eOne of Spanish cinema’s great auteurs, Carlos Saura brought international audiences closer to the art of his country’s dance than any other filmmaker, before or since. In his Flamenco Trilogy—Blood Wedding, Carmen, and El amor brujo—Saura merged his passion for music with his exploration of national identity. All starring and choreographed by legendary dancer Antonio Gades, the films feature thrilling physicality and electrifying cinematography and editing—colorful paeans to bodies in motion as well as to cinema itself.\u003c\/p\u003e \n\n\u003cp\u003eBLOOD WEDDING Carlos Saura began what would become his Flamenco Trilogy with this depiction of a single dress rehearsal for choreographer Antonio Gades’s adaptation of poet and playwright Federico García Lorca’s tale of passionate revenge. No mere recording of a ballet, Blood Wedding (Bodas de sangre) uses gripping camera work and heart-pounding rhythmic editing to evoke the experience of moving with the dancers every step of the way.\u003c\/p\u003e \n\n\u003cp\u003eCARMEN Carlos Saura’s biggest international box-office success was this self-reflexive meditation on both Georges Bizet’s popular opera Carmen and the original novella by Prosper Mérimée. Antonio Gades plays a choreographer who gets involved with his neophyte lead dancer (Laura del Sol), and grows dangerously jealous. Depicting the ups and downs of their affair in between rehearsals for Gades’s ballet, Carmen is a visually hypnotic hall of mirrors in which the dancers become inseparable from their personas.\u003c\/p\u003e \n\n\u003cp\u003eEL AMOR BRUJO The Flamenco Trilogy’s most straightforward narrative is also its most forthrightly theatrical, a modern take on composer Manuel de Falla’s Roma ballet, dressed up in pink sunsets and hellishly red fires. Set in a dusty Andalusian village, El amor brujo (Love, the Magician) is a seductive melodrama of a man (Antonio Gades) whose beloved is haunted by the ghost of another.\u003c\/p\u003e \n\n\u003cp\u003eZone Region: A\u003c\/p\u003e \n\n\u003cp\u003eRegion A: Region A titles are suitable for USA and Canada.
